Home
last modified time | relevance | path

Searched refs:mvendorid (Results 1 - 9 of 9) sorted by relevance

/kernel/linux/linux-6.6/tools/perf/arch/riscv/util/
H A Dheader.c15 #define CPUINFO_MVEN "mvendorid"
39 char *mvendorid = NULL; in _get_cpuid() local
53 mvendorid = _get_field(line); in _get_cpuid()
54 if (!mvendorid) in _get_cpuid()
69 if (!mvendorid || !marchid || !mimpid) in _get_cpuid()
72 if (asprintf(&cpuid, "%s-%s-%s", mvendorid, marchid, mimpid) < 0) in _get_cpuid()
77 free(mvendorid); in _get_cpuid()
/kernel/linux/linux-6.6/arch/riscv/kernel/
H A Dcpu.c148 return ci->mvendorid; in riscv_cached_mvendorid()
173 ci->mvendorid = sbi_spec_is_0_1() ? 0 : sbi_get_mvendorid(); in riscv_cpuinfo_starting()
177 ci->mvendorid = csr_read(CSR_MVENDORID); in riscv_cpuinfo_starting()
181 ci->mvendorid = 0; in riscv_cpuinfo_starting()
293 seq_printf(m, "mvendorid\t: 0x%lx\n", ci->mvendorid); in c_show()
/kernel/linux/linux-6.6/arch/riscv/include/asm/
H A Dcpufeature.h17 unsigned long mvendorid; member
H A Dkvm_host.h178 unsigned long mvendorid; member
/kernel/linux/linux-6.6/arch/riscv/kvm/
H A Dvcpu_onereg.c146 case KVM_REG_RISCV_CONFIG_REG(mvendorid): in kvm_riscv_vcpu_get_reg_config()
147 reg_val = vcpu->arch.mvendorid; in kvm_riscv_vcpu_get_reg_config()
237 case KVM_REG_RISCV_CONFIG_REG(mvendorid): in kvm_riscv_vcpu_set_reg_config()
238 if (reg_val == vcpu->arch.mvendorid) in kvm_riscv_vcpu_set_reg_config()
241 vcpu->arch.mvendorid = reg_val; in kvm_riscv_vcpu_set_reg_config()
H A Dvcpu_sbi_base.c53 *out_val = vcpu->arch.mvendorid; in kvm_sbi_ext_base_handler()
H A Dvcpu.c112 vcpu->arch.mvendorid = sbi_get_mvendorid(); in kvm_arch_vcpu_create()
/kernel/linux/linux-6.6/arch/riscv/include/uapi/asm/
H A Dkvm.h54 unsigned long mvendorid; member
/kernel/linux/linux-6.6/tools/testing/selftests/kvm/riscv/
H A Dget-reg-list.c127 case KVM_REG_RISCV_CONFIG_REG(mvendorid): in config_id_to_str()
128 return "KVM_REG_RISCV_CONFIG_REG(mvendorid)"; in config_id_to_str()
488 KVM_REG_RISCV | KVM_REG_SIZE_ULONG | KVM_REG_RISCV_CONFIG | KVM_REG_RISCV_CONFIG_REG(mvendorid),

Completed in 7 milliseconds